## Project Overview
|
|
|
|
This is the eBPF Developer Tutorial repository - a comprehensive learning resource for eBPF development. It provides 48+ practical examples progressing from beginner to advanced topics using modern eBPF frameworks like libbpf, Cilium eBPF, and libbpf-rs.

## Architecture
|
|
|
|
### Build System
|
|
- **Framework**: GNU Make with libbpf
|
|
- **BPF Compilation**: Clang/LLVM compiles `.bpf.c` → `.bpf.o`
|
|
- **Skeleton Generation**: bpftool generates `.skel.h` from BPF objects
|
|
- **User Space**: GCC compiles C programs linking with libbpf
|
|
- **Dependencies**: All in `src/third_party/` (libbpf, bpftool, blazesym, vmlinux headers)

### Key Components
|
|
1. **vmlinux headers**: Pre-generated for x86, arm, arm64, riscv, powerpc, loongarch
|
|
2. **CO-RE (Compile Once, Run Everywhere)**: Uses BTF for kernel compatibility
|
|
3. **Multiple frameworks**: libbpf (primary), eunomia-bpf, Cilium eBPF, libbpf-rs |
